Significance of the Ashes
For over 140 years, the Ashes series has been a defining aspect of cricket history. The term ‘The Ashes’ originated in 1882, when Australia first defeated England on British soil. The series comprises five Test matches, where both teams compete for a small urn symbolizing cricket supremacy. Looking Forward: Key Players and Teams
According to current sports analyses, the Australian team, under the captaincy of Pat Cummins, is expected to present a robust challenge to England’s test squad, led by Ben Stokes. Both captains have shown promising leadership skills, with impressive track records in recent matches. Notably, players like Steve Smith and Joe Root are anticipated to play pivotal roles with their batting prowess, while bowlers like Josh Hazlewood and Jofra Archer are critical for their sides’ bowling attacks.
